Understanding Car Locksmith Services
A cheap car key locksmith near me locksmith is a specialized expert trained to deal with all aspects of automotive lock and key problems. These experts are geared up with the knowledge and tools to help with a variety of issues, including:

- Key Extraction: Retrieving keys that are stuck in the ignition or door lock.
- Key Duplication: Making copies of your existing car keys.
- Lockout Assistance: Gaining entry to your vehicle when you are locked out.
- Key Programming: Programming brand-new keys for modern cars with transponder chips.
- Lock Replacement: Replacing harmed or defective locks.
- Ignition Repair: Fixing concerns with the ignition system.
When to Call a Car Locksmith
There are numerous situations in which you may need to call a car locksmith:
- Locked Out of Your Car: The most typical reason, where you accidentally lock your keys inside the car.
- Lost or Stolen Keys: If you lose your car keys or they are stolen, a locksmith can supply new keys and reprogram them for your vehicle.
- Key Breakage: If your key breaks off in the lock, a locksmith can extract the broken piece and provide a brand-new key.
- Lock Malfunction: If your mobile car locksmith's lock is jammed or not functioning effectively, a locksmith can detect and repair the issue.
- Emergency Situations: In cases where you require instant access to your vehicle, such as being stranded in a remote area.

Often Asked Questions (FAQs)
Q: How much does it cost to get a car locksmith?
A: The expense of car locksmith services can differ depending upon the type of service, the complexity of the problem, and the area. Typically, a standard lockout service can vary from ₤ 50 to ₤ 150, while more complicated tasks like key programming or lock replacement may cost more. It's constantly a great concept to get a quote before the locksmith begins work.
Q: Can a car locksmith make a brand-new key if I do not have any existing keys?
A: Yes, a professional car locksmith can develop a brand-new key even if you don't have any existing keys. They will require the Vehicle Identification Number (VIN) and may need proof of ownership to comply with security guidelines.
Q: How long does it take for a car locksmith to get here?
A: The reaction time can vary depending upon the locksmith's schedule and your place. Numerous locksmith professionals offer quick reaction services and can show up within 30 minutes to an hour. In some cases, it may take longer during peak hours.
Q: Will the locksmith damage my car while gaining entry?
A: A reputable car locksmith will use non-invasive techniques to acquire entry to your vehicle. However, in many cases, small damage might occur, particularly if the lock is particularly stubborn. The locksmith must notify you if this is a possibility.
Q: Can I get a car locksmith if I have a blowout or other non-lock-related concerns?
A: Car locksmiths car key focus on lock and key services. If you have a flat tire or other mechanical issues, you should call a tow truck or a mechanic. However, some locksmiths may offer extra services, so it's worth asking.
Q: Is it legal for a car locksmith to make a copy of my key?
A: Yes, it is legal for a car locksmith to make a copy of your key, provided they have your authorization and you can show ownership of the vehicle. Some states have specific laws concerning key duplication, so it's essential to validate the locksmith's compliance with local guidelines.
Tips for Preventing Car Lockouts
While it's constantly great to have a dependable car locksmith on speed dial, prevention is key to preventing lockouts and the involved stress. Here are some pointers to help you avoid car lockouts:
- Always Have a Spare Key: Keep a spare type in a safe and secure location, such as a safe at home or with a trusted buddy or relative.
- Key Fobs and Remote Starters: Consider using key fobs or remote beginners, which can help you avoid lockouts.
- Routine Maintenance: Ensure your car's locks are well-maintained and lubricated to prevent wear and tear.
- Inspect Your Pockets: Make it a routine to examine your pockets and bags before locking your car to guarantee you have your keys.
- Locksmith Services in Advance: If you often lose your keys or have an older vehicle, think about having a car locksmith make a spare key in advance.
